Challenges: Navigating the Complexities of Clinical Trial Insights Generation

Navigating the complexities of generating insights from clinical trials involves numerous challenges, starting with the imperative to process data safely and securely. Given the sensitivity and confidentiality of patient information, robust data management systems are essential, ensuring compliance with stringent regulatory requirements while safeguarding privacy. The task extends beyond mere storage; it encompasses implementation of encryption, access controls, and data anonymization protocols to mitigate risks effectively.

Another critical challenge is the sheer volume and complexity of clinical trial datasets which include metadata and raw sequence data. Moreover, serving the needs of organizations and clinical study sites spread across diverse locations adds an additional layer of complexity to the process.

Architecture Design

The fundamental design principle of the Pharma Services platform centers around precise data annotation and curation. These critical processes are essential for extracting meaningful insights from clinical studies. As raw data volumes continue to grow, scalable architectures become crucial. The platform achieves scalability both vertically and horizontally by adhering to predefined rules and metrics.

BluMaiden-Architecture-Diagram

High-level data flow:

  1. Raw sequenced data from the clinical trial site is uploaded to an encrypted Amazon S3 bucket.
  2. De-identified metadata relating to the samples shared by site is uploaded to the same Amazon S3 bucket.
  3. Data shaping and processing is done using pre-defined Amazon Elastic Container Registry (ECR) images and AWS batch which uses Amazon EC2 spot instances to spin up required containers for processing.
  4. Intermediate and processed data is stored back in separate folders with the study specific Amazon S3 bucket.
  5. Data volume increases multiple folds as we start the processing and DNA is sequenced, some of this data is archived for compliance using the Amazon S3 Glacier.
  6. Processed data in study specific Amazon S3 bucket and folder is used by the BluMaiden computational team for data analysis using Amazon SageMaker.

Platform Benefits

The Pharma Service platform has features to ensure the success of day-to-day operations in clinical trial data processing. Here are the main features of the platform:

  1. BluMaiden Pharma Services’ platform facilitates data ingestion, including initial, incremental, and re-processing approaches, customized for specific use cases. Leveraging Amazon S3 for data storage and retrieval, BluMaiden and its partners have achieved a 36% reduction in secure data sharing time using Amazon S3 pre-signed URL feature.
  2. Utilizing Amazon S3, BluMaiden Pharma Services has achieved a 42% reduction in data costs through lifecycle management policies. By strategically transitioning data to lower and archival tiers, they ensure cost-effective data management. Additionally, the platform integrates built-in capabilities and leverages Amazon S3 features like Content-MD5 and ETag for verifying uploaded objects, thereby maintaining data quality from raw sequenced data to processed information.
  3. To optimize costs, BluMaiden leverages the AWS Batch service in conjunction with Amazon EC2 Spot Instances, resulting in a 30-50% reduction in expenses. Additionally, the platform seamlessly integrates with the BioContainers community, which is accessible through the Amazon ECR Public Gallery.
  4. At scale, Amazon EC2 Spot Instances across availability zones and provides partners with clinically insightful data analysis up to 2.5x times faster.

By decoupling storage and compute components through a serverless approach using services like Amazon S3, BluMaiden benefits from resilient systems that remain operational even in the face of component failures. These modular structures allow flexible adaptation of storage and consumption methods without disrupting overall data flow. Additionally, BluMaiden’s data repositories in Amazon S3 facilitate seamless global data sharing and re-analysis.
